We do not have a fuel cell, but yes, we finally cured our fueling issues. It only took a bunch of experimenting with baffles, trap doors and the factory siphon valve do draw fuel from the opposite side of the tank. The only problem now is that when it runs out of gas, its OUT with hardly any warning. Before it would fuel starve after every left hand corner for laps until we finally decided to bring it in.
